In a potential season-changing victory the Indiana Hoosiers men's basketball earned their biggest win of the regular season with a 71-67 victory over the Michigan State Spartans.

Indiana upset No.11 Michigan State at the Breslin Center on a night where Tom Izzo was trying to pass Hoosier legendary head coach Bobby Knight in wins, sorry coach Izzo it'll have to wait til Michigan State's next game.

Power forward Malik Reneau lead the Hoosiers in scoring and boards with (19 points, 12 rebounds). Center, Oumar Ballo was not too far behind with (14 points, 10 rebounds), senior forward Luke Goode and sophomore guard Myles Rice also were in double figures with 10 points a piece.

The Hoosiers were able to end their five game losing streak, they also left Tom Izzo tied with Bob Knight as previously mentioned with 345 wins which is tied for second in Big Ten history with coach Knight.

Super freshman and future NBA lottery pick Jase Richardson only scored 13 points and guard Jaden Akins had 14 to go along with and Frankie Fidler's 12 points for the Spartans. Indiana and their zone defense held the Spartans to 38.2% shooting from the field and 4-of-23 on 3-pointers.

“I thought the zone saved us tonight,” Woodson said on the Peacock broadcast after the contest.

Izzo and the Spartans will try for the Big Ten wins record again on the road Saturday at Illinois, with tip-off set for 8 p.m.

After losing five straight and seven of eight not only was a win needed but a win versus a Quad 1 opponent, was huge. It truly gives Indiana some hope and life for the NCAA tournament conversation but is it enough to put Indiana in March Madness brackets next month? Only time will tell.

The Hoosiers (15-10, 6-8) host the UCLA Bruins (18-6, 9-4) on Friday night, UCLA enters the game on a 7 game winning streak.
